MAMEWAH to MAME Config Questions
« on: October 07, 2009, 09:34:18 pm »
So I've got Mame up and running in my C:\MAME folder.  (and play tested with a game).
I've got MAMEWAH up and running installed in C:\MAMEWAH.
Went into the config .ini for MAMEWAH and pointed the emulator at the C:\Mame\MAME.EXE
Went into the config .ini for MAMEWAH and pointed the rom path to C:\MAME\ROMS

When I Start Mamewah It doesn't recognize MAME or the ROM installed???

Anybody see what I'm doing wrong?

Also, there are multiple .ini files with in the config folder for MAMEWAH, do I need to update them all to point at the emulator and or the roms?

Re: MAMEWAH to MAME Config Questions
« Reply #1 on: October 07, 2009, 09:40:07 pm »
Have you went into the options menu and selected Generate List? Do you have the rom extension set to ZIP? Have you read the WIKI?

Have you made a MAME folder in the CONFIG folder and set up the INI for it?
